ʔaq’amnik School needs your votes
The ʔaq’amnik School has entered into Aviva Canada’s competition to receive funding to create a playground for The Blank Canvas-Our Playground.
The ʔaq’amnik School was newly reopened in 2012 (pictured above) but has yet to secure enough funds to develop and create a playground for their students.
